Bug 2270227 - [abrt] ibus-rime: std::_Sp_counted_base<(__gnu_cxx::_Lock_policy)2>::_M_release(): ibus-engine-rime killed by SIGSEGV
Summary: [abrt] ibus-rime: std::_Sp_counted_base<(__gnu_cxx::_Lock_policy)2>::_M_relea...
Keywords:
Status: CLOSED NOTABUG
Alias: None
Product: Fedora
Classification: Fedora
Component: ibus-rime
Version: 39
Hardware: x86_64
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: Peng Wu
QA Contact: Fedora Extras Quality Assurance
URL: https://retrace.fedoraproject.org/faf...
Whiteboard: abrt_hash:65b87b45a9e995afda800e61151...
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2024-03-19 05:58 UTC by ylx30130
Modified: 2024-04-05 23:58 UTC (History)
4 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2024-04-01 02:38:40 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)
File: proc_pid_status (1.49 KB, text/plain)
2024-03-19 05:58 UTC, ylx30130
no flags Details
File: maps (3.90 KB, text/plain)
2024-03-19 05:58 UTC, ylx30130
no flags Details
File: limits (1.29 KB, text/plain)
2024-03-19 05:58 UTC, ylx30130
no flags Details
File: environ (1.51 KB,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: open_fds (1.21 KB,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: mountinfo (2.88 KB,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: os_info (734 bytes,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: cpuinfo (3.08 KB,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: core_backtrace (17.80 KB,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: exploitable (81 bytes,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: dso_list (648 bytes,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details
File: backtrace (51.77 KB, text/plain)
2024-03-19 05:59 UTC, ylx30130
no flags Details

Description ylx30130 2024-03-19 05:58:50 UTC
Version-Release number of selected component:
ibus-rime-1.5.0-7.fc39

Additional info:
reporter:       libreport-2.17.11
type:           CCpp
reason:         ibus-engine-rime killed by SIGSEGV
journald_cursor: s=625d004b3b0a4a63997b281eb7d80d59;i=22a32;b=fcdfb51170a84076a5b9a8c9326954fd;m=40248a8b2;t=613fcfda50840;x=dced373c335a04fc
executable:     /usr/libexec/ibus-rime/ibus-engine-rime
cmdline:        /usr/libexec/ibus-rime/ibus-engine-rime --ibus
cgroup:         0::/user.slice/user-1000.slice/user/session.slice/org.freedesktop.IBus.session.GNOME.service
rootdir:        /
uid:            1000
kernel:         6.7.9-200.fc39.x86_64
package:        ibus-rime-1.5.0-7.fc39
runlevel:       N 5
backtrace_rating: 4
crash_function: std::_Sp_counted_base<(__gnu_cxx::_Lock_policy)2>::_M_release

Truncated backtrace:
Thread no. 1 (22 frames)
 #0 std::_Sp_counted_base<(__gnu_cxx::_Lock_policy)2>::_M_release at /usr/include/c++/13/bits/shared_ptr_base.h:337
 #1 std::__shared_count<(__gnu_cxx::_Lock_policy)2>::~__shared_count at /usr/include/c++/13/bits/shared_ptr_base.h:1071
 #2 std::__shared_ptr<rime::Session, (__gnu_cxx::_Lock_policy)2>::~__shared_ptr at /usr/include/c++/13/bits/shared_ptr_base.h:1524
 #3 std::shared_ptr<rime::Session>::~shared_ptr at /usr/include/c++/13/bits/shared_ptr.h:175
 #4 std::pair<unsigned long const, std::shared_ptr<rime::Session> >::~pair at /usr/include/c++/13/bits/stl_pair.h:187
 #5 std::__new_allocator<std::_Rb_tree_node<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> >::destroy<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> at /usr/include/c++/13/bits/new_allocator.h:194
 #6 std::allocator_traits<std::allocator<std::_Rb_tree_node<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> > >::destroy<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> at /usr/include/c++/13/bits/alloc_traits.h:557
 #7 std::_Rb_tree<unsigned long, std::pair<unsigned long const, std::shared_ptr<rime::Session> >, std::_Select1st<std::pair<unsigned long const, std::shared_ptr<rime::Session> > >, std::less<unsigned long>, std::allocator<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> >::_M_destroy_node at /usr/include/c++/13/bits/stl_tree.h:625
 #8 std::_Rb_tree<unsigned long, std::pair<unsigned long const, std::shared_ptr<rime::Session> >, std::_Select1st<std::pair<unsigned long const, std::shared_ptr<rime::Session> > >, std::less<unsigned long>, std::allocator<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> >::_M_drop_node at /usr/include/c++/13/bits/stl_tree.h:633
 #9 std::_Rb_tree<unsigned long, std::pair<unsigned long const, std::shared_ptr<rime::Session> >, std::_Select1st<std::pair<unsigned long const, std::shared_ptr<rime::Session> > >, std::less<unsigned long>, std::allocator<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> >::_M_erase at /usr/include/c++/13/bits/stl_tree.h:1938
 #10 std::_Rb_tree<unsigned long, std::pair<unsigned long const, std::shared_ptr<rime::Session> >, std::_Select1st<std::pair<unsigned long const, std::shared_ptr<rime::Session> > >, std::less<unsigned long>, std::allocator<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> >::clear at /usr/include/c++/13/bits/stl_tree.h:1255
 #11 std::map<unsigned long, std::shared_ptr<rime::Session>, std::less<unsigned long>, std::allocator<std::pair<unsigned long const, std::shared_ptr<rime::Session> > > >::clear at /usr/include/c++/13/bits/stl_map.h:1184
 #12 rime::Service::CleanupAllSessions at /usr/src/debug/librime-1.8.5-3.fc39.x86_64/src/rime/service.cc:150
 #13 RimeFinalize at /usr/src/debug/librime-1.8.5-3.fc39.x86_64/src/rime_api.cc:85
 #14 ibus_rime_stop at /usr/src/debug/ibus-rime-1.5.0-7.fc39.x86_64/rime_main.c:84
 #15 sigterm_cb at /usr/src/debug/ibus-rime-1.5.0-7.fc39.x86_64/rime_main.c:138
 #17 syscall at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:37
 #18 g_cond_wait at ../glib/gthread-posix.c:1552
 #19 g_async_queue_pop_intern_unlocked at ../glib/gasyncqueue.c:425
 #20 g_thread_pool_spawn_thread at ../glib/gthreadpool.c:311
 #21 g_thread_proxy at ../glib/gthread.c:831
 #23 clone3 at ../sysdeps/unix/sysv/linux/x86_64/clone3.S:78

Comment 1 ylx30130 2024-03-19 05:58:54 UTC
Created attachment 2022436 [details]
File: proc_pid_status

Comment 2 ylx30130 2024-03-19 05:58:57 UTC
Created attachment 2022437 [details]
File: maps

Comment 3 ylx30130 2024-03-19 05:58:59 UTC
Created attachment 2022438 [details]
File: limits

Comment 4 ylx30130 2024-03-19 05:59:02 UTC
Created attachment 2022439 [details]
File: environ

Comment 5 ylx30130 2024-03-19 05:59:04 UTC
Created attachment 2022440 [details]
File: open_fds

Comment 6 ylx30130 2024-03-19 05:59:06 UTC
Created attachment 2022441 [details]
File: mountinfo

Comment 7 ylx30130 2024-03-19 05:59:09 UTC
Created attachment 2022442 [details]
File: os_info

Comment 8 ylx30130 2024-03-19 05:59:11 UTC
Created attachment 2022443 [details]
File: cpuinfo

Comment 9 ylx30130 2024-03-19 05:59:13 UTC
Created attachment 2022444 [details]
File: core_backtrace

Comment 10 ylx30130 2024-03-19 05:59:16 UTC
Created attachment 2022445 [details]
File: exploitable

Comment 11 ylx30130 2024-03-19 05:59:18 UTC
Created attachment 2022446 [details]
File: dso_list

Comment 12 ylx30130 2024-03-19 05:59:21 UTC
Created attachment 2022447 [details]
File: backtrace

Comment 13 Parag Nemade 2024-03-24 10:32:55 UTC
How can this bug be reproduced? 
Can you give us steps to reproduce this bug?
Is this bug happening frequently or happened only once?

Comment 14 ylx30130 2024-04-05 23:58:40 UTC
(In reply to Parag Nemade from comment #13)
> How can this bug be reproduced? 
> Can you give us steps to reproduce this bug?
> Is this bug happening frequently or happened only once?

It only happened once. 
It cannot be reproduced. 
It should not be a bug and has been closed.
Thank you for your attention.


Note You need to log in before you can comment on or make changes to this bug.